529 template <typename LookupKeyT>
530 BucketT *InsertIntoBucketImpl(const KeyT &Key, const LookupKeyT &Lookup,
531 BucketT *TheBucket) {
534 // If the load of the hash table is more than 3/4, or if fewer than 1/8 of
535 // the buckets are empty (meaning that many are filled with tombstones),
538 // The later case is tricky. For example, if we had one empty bucket with
539 // tons of tombstones, failing lookups (e.g. for insertion) would have to
540 // probe almost the entire table until it found the empty bucket. If the
541 // table completely filled with tombstones, no lookup would ever succeed,
542 // causing infinite loops in lookup.
543 unsigned NewNumEntries = getNumEntries() + 1;
544 unsigned NumBuckets = getNumBuckets();
545 if (LLVM_UNLIKELY(NewNumEntries * 4 >= NumBuckets * 3)) {
546 this->grow(NumBuckets * 2);
547 LookupBucketFor(Lookup, TheBucket);
548 NumBuckets = getNumBuckets();
549 } else if (LLVM_UNLIKELY(NumBuckets-(NewNumEntries+getNumTombstones()) <=
551 this->grow(NumBuckets);
552 LookupBucketFor(Lookup, TheBucket);
556 // Only update the state after we've grown our bucket space appropriately
557 // so that when growing buckets we have self-consistent entry count.
558 incrementNumEntries();
560 // If we are writing over a tombstone, remember this.
561 const KeyT EmptyKey = getEmptyKey();
562 if (!KeyInfoT::isEqual(TheBucket->getFirst(), EmptyKey))
563 decrementNumTombstones();
568 /// LookupBucketFor - Lookup the appropriate bucket for Val, returning it in
569 /// FoundBucket. If the bucket contains the key and a value, this returns
570 /// true, otherwise it returns a bucket with an empty marker or tombstone and
572 template<typename LookupKeyT>
573 bool LookupBucketFor(const LookupKeyT &Val,
574 const BucketT *&FoundBucket) const {
575 const BucketT *BucketsPtr = getBuckets();
576 const unsigned NumBuckets = getNumBuckets();
578 if (NumBuckets == 0) {
579 FoundBucket = nullptr;
583 // FoundTombstone - Keep track of whether we find a tombstone while probing.
584 const BucketT *FoundTombstone = nullptr;
585 const KeyT EmptyKey = getEmptyKey();
586 const KeyT TombstoneKey = getTombstoneKey();
587 assert(!KeyInfoT::isEqual(Val, EmptyKey) &&
588 !KeyInfoT::isEqual(Val, TombstoneKey) &&
589 "Empty/Tombstone value shouldn't be inserted into map!");
591 unsigned BucketNo = getHashValue(Val) & (NumBuckets-1);
592 unsigned ProbeAmt = 1;
594 const BucketT *ThisBucket = BucketsPtr + BucketNo;
595 // Found Val's bucket? If so, return it.
596 if (LLVM_LIKELY(KeyInfoT::isEqual(Val, ThisBucket->getFirst()))) {
597 FoundBucket = ThisBucket;
601 // If we found an empty bucket, the key doesn't exist in the set.
602 // Insert it and return the default value.
603 if (LLVM_LIKELY(KeyInfoT::isEqual(ThisBucket->getFirst(), EmptyKey))) {
604 // If we've already seen a tombstone while probing, fill it in instead
605 // of the empty bucket we eventually probed to.
606 FoundBucket = FoundTombstone ? FoundTombstone : ThisBucket;
610 // If this is a tombstone, remember it. If Val ends up not in the map, we
611 // prefer to return it than something that would require more probing.
612 if (KeyInfoT::isEqual(ThisBucket->getFirst(), TombstoneKey) &&
614 FoundTombstone = ThisBucket; // Remember the first tombstone found.
616 // Otherwise, it's a hash collision or a tombstone, continue quadratic
618 BucketNo += ProbeAmt++;
619 BucketNo &= (NumBuckets-1);
